Funnier By The Lake Comedy returns to Madame Zuzu’s brand new, larger venue! The ONLY live stand up comedy in Highland Park. This month’s showcase includes:

HOST:
Katie Meiners

Katie Meiners is a stand-up comic who performs at The Improv, Zanies, The Comedy Shrine and beyond. She’s a graduate of The Second City Chicago’s Comedy Writing Program and of The University of Michigan and was named first runner-up in a wildly contentious Melon Queen Pageant in the mid-2000s. Katie produces Chicago’s Finest Stand-Up in Glenview, Illinois, and is the host of The Quatro Comedy Show, an improvised night of comedy in downtown Wheaton. She enjoys reading to kids, line-dancing and onions. In her free time, she commutes.


Conor Cawley
Hailing from Chicago, Conor Cawley is a comedian, writer, and world-renowned sweetheart. While he has spent most of his life in the Windy City, he has traveled the world from Brussels, Belgium to San Diego, California to cultivate a unique take on life and comedy. Conor is the Director of Live Events for Don’t Tell Comedy, helping to launch the secret comedy show in new cities. He’s also the founder of Rat Pack Comedy, a now-defunct dapper comedy show in which comedians dressed in their Sunday best to perform in Chicago’s Wrigleyville neighborhood. He’s featured at Zanies, the World Famous Laugh Factory, and the Comedy Palace. He has also had the pleasure of performing in the Hoboken Comedy Festival, the Whiskey Bear Festival in Columbus, Ohio, and Epic Fest in Edison Park, Chicago.


Kenyan Adamcik
After realizing that getting a decent SAT score wasn’t Kenyon’s true calling in life, he started stand up in high school and has gone on to open for Todd Glass, Tim Dillon, Ian Edwards, and Big Jay Oakerson. His comedy has also been featured on Sirius XM. Kenyon is a sought-out comedian in Chicago and is a regular at the Laugh Factory, Zanie’s and Comedy Bar, along with Good Nights and Helium. Growing up biracial with disabled parents, Kenyon brings a unique perspective to the stage that leaves audiences wanting more.


HEADLINER:
Jeanie Doogan
Jeanie started her career at the tender age of five when she quickly learned that as the youngest of eight children she needed a hook if she ever wanted to be fed, bathed, or have her existence acknowledged in any way. Failing miserably at tap dancing, Irish dancing, gymnastics, and academics, she carved out her comedy niche with kick-ass knock-knock jokes and soon rose to fame at the family dinner table with such classics as: “knock-knock.” “knock-knock.” “knock-knock! Open the door! You left me outside again!” Since her kitchen table debut, Jeanie has entertained audiences at colleges, casinos, and corporate events, and is a regular at venues such as  Zanies Comedy Clubs, The Laugh Factory, and The Comedy Bar. She was highlighted in Chicago Parents’ Magazine’s Four of Chicago’s Funniest: Stand Up Parents, and was featured on Nick Jr.’s Moms’ Night Out debut stand up special. Jeanie has set herself apart with her quick observations and no-apology take on teaching, parenthood, and American culture. Her sharp wit draws on her experiences growing up on the South side of Chicago and 20 years as a public school teacher to deliver comedy that reaches audiences of all walks of life.
